1

Windows システムに単純なバッチ ファイルがあります -
@echo off
echo %1 >> %2

このバッチ ファイルは 2 つの引数を取ります。1 番目は文字列、2 番目はファイル名です。渡された文字列をファイルに追加します。

このバッチ ファイルをコマンド ラインから実行するのは簡単ですが、GUI から実行する必要があります。

このバッチファイルをブラウザから実行することはできますか? 2 つの引数を受け取る単純な HTML ファイルを作成し、ボタンを押すとこのバッチ ファイルを実行できますか?

このバッチ ファイルを実行するための簡単な GUI を作成する他の方法はありますか?

4

1 に答える 1

2

Web ブラウザ内で JavaScript からコマンド ライン呼び出しを実行することはできません。これは、セキュリティ リスクが原因です。

ただし、他の複数の方法を使用できます。Java の知識があれば、コマンド ラインを呼び出す Swing インターフェイスを使用して、非常に単純な Java プログラムを作成できます。また、localhost で php ページを実行することもできます。これにより、ブラウザーに html フロント エンドがあり、サーバーに要求を送信して呼び出しを行うことができます。

于 2012-06-22T16:54:07.863 に答える